UNCOMPRESSEDAUDIOFORMAT 結構 (audiomediatype.h)
UNCOMPRESSEDAUDIOFORMAT 結構會指定未壓縮音訊數據格式的幀速率、通道遮罩和其他屬性。
語法
typedef struct _UNCOMPRESSEDAUDIOFORMAT {
GUID guidFormatType;
DWORD dwSamplesPerFrame;
DWORD dwBytesPerSampleContainer;
DWORD dwValidBitsPerSample;
FLOAT fFramesPerSecond;
DWORD dwChannelMask;
} UNCOMPRESSEDAUDIOFORMAT;
成員
guidFormatType
指定數據類型的 GUID。
dwSamplesPerFrame
指定每個畫面的樣本數目。
dwBytesPerSampleContainer
指定組成範例單位容器的位元組數目。
dwValidBitsPerSample
指定每個範例的有效位數目。
fFramesPerSecond
指定每秒串流音訊數據的畫面數。
dwChannelMask
指定未壓縮音訊數據所使用的通道掩碼。
備註
此結構可讓您存取描述未壓縮 PCM 音訊格式的參數。
規格需求
需求 | 值 |
---|---|
最低支援的用戶端 | 適用於 Windows Vista 和更新版本的 Windows。 |
標頭 | audiomediatype.h (包含 Audiomediatype.h) |